Unleash the Power of Math for Machine Learning and AI Jobs

Unleash the Power of Math for Machine Learning and AI Jobs

Table of Contents

  1. Introduction
  2. Importance of Math in Data Science
    • 2.1 Math in Machine Learning
    • 2.2 Bellman's Optimality Equations
    • 2.3 Value Function and Probability Equation
    • 2.4 Markov Decision Process
    • 2.5 Q Function and Action Value Function
  3. Math in Machine Learning
    • 3.1 Linear Regression
    • 3.2 KL Divergence and Cross-Entropy
    • 3.3 Mean Squared Error and Mean Absolute Error
    • 3.4 Variance Inflation Factors
  4. Learning the Right Mathematical Equation
    • 4.1 Understanding When to Use Which Equation
    • 4.2 Importance of Knowing the Right Equation
  5. Math in Industry
    • 5.1 Choosing the Right Algorithm for Automation
    • 5.2 Hiring Based on Project Experience
  6. Learning Math as a Beginner
    • 6.1 Focusing on Project Demands
    • 6.2 Starting with Simple Data Sets and Algorithms
    • 6.3 Understanding the Why behind Math
  7. The Importance of Math at Every Experience Level
    • 7.1 Math for Freshers and Experienced Professionals
  8. Conclusion

Importance of Math in Learning Data Science and Machine Learning

Mathematics plays a crucial role in the field of data science and machine learning. It serves as the foundation for understanding complex algorithms and models, enabling professionals to make accurate predictions and automate processes. This article explores the significance of math in data science and machine learning and why it is essential for professionals to have a strong understanding of mathematical concepts and equations.

1. Introduction

Data science and machine learning have revolutionized various industries by providing insights and predictions that drive business growth. These fields heavily rely on mathematical principles and equations to analyze data, build models, and make data-driven decisions. While programming skills are often emphasized in these domains, the importance of math should not be underestimated.

2. Importance of Math in Data Science

2.1 Math in Machine Learning

Machine learning involves training models to recognize Patterns and make predictions based on data. However, the behavior and decision-making capabilities of these models are determined by mathematical equations. For instance, Bellman's optimality equations and the Bellman expectation equation play significant roles in self-driving car technology, defining how vehicles should behave in different scenarios.

2.2 Bellman's Optimality Equations

Bellman's optimality equations help evaluate the behavior of an agent and determine the optimal policy. In the Context of self-driving cars, these equations dictate how the car should act at traffic lights, considering factors like green or red signals. Understanding these equations is crucial for creating efficient and safe autonomous driving systems.

2.3 Value Function and Probability Equation

The value function, represented by the equation V(s) = R(s) + γ Σ P(s', s) V(s'), evaluates the desirability of a particular state in a Markov Decision Process. Probability equations, such as transition probabilities between states, are essential for determining the likelihood of moving from one state to another. These concepts are fundamental for training machine learning models and reinforcement learning algorithms.

2.4 Markov Decision Process

Markov Decision Process (MDP) is a mathematical framework used in decision-making processes. It involves a tuple of states, actions, transition probabilities, and rewards. Understanding MDP and the associated equations allows data scientists to identify the best actions to take in different states to maximize rewards.

2.5 Q Function and Action Value Function

The Q function (action value function) is another crucial concept in reinforcement learning. It represents the expected rewards when taking a particular action in a particular state. By optimizing the Q function, data scientists can build robust models capable of making optimal decisions in various environments.

3. Math in Machine Learning

Apart from the complex mathematical concepts Mentioned earlier, machine learning encompasses simpler equations that form the building blocks of models and algorithms. Whether it's linear regression, KL divergence, cross-entropy, or mean squared error, each equation serves a specific purpose in capturing and quantifying relationships within data.

3.1 Linear Regression

Linear regression is a basic yet essential equation in machine learning. It helps establish a linear relationship between the independent and dependent variables, allowing data scientists to make predictions based on this relationship.

3.2 KL Divergence and Cross-Entropy

KL divergence and cross-entropy are commonly used in information theory and machine learning. These equations help measure the difference between probability distributions, allowing data scientists to evaluate the accuracy and efficiency of their models.

3.3 Mean Squared Error and Mean Absolute Error

Mean squared error (MSE) and mean absolute error (MAE) are performance metrics used to assess the accuracy of regression models. These equations quantify the deviation between predicted and actual values, helping data scientists understand the performance of their models.

3.4 Variance Inflation Factors

Variance inflation factors (VIF) are used to assess multicollinearity in regression analysis. They help identify the correlation between independent variables, enabling data scientists to eliminate redundant variables and improve model performance.

4. Learning the Right Mathematical Equation

While it may seem overwhelming to learn numerous mathematical equations, it is crucial to understand when and how to use them effectively. The focus should not be on memorizing every equation but rather on understanding the context in which it should be applied. This knowledge allows data scientists to select the most appropriate mathematical equation for a given problem or project.

4.1 Understanding When to Use Which Equation

Data scientists must develop an intuition for recognizing scenarios where specific equations can drive Meaningful insights. By understanding the problem at HAND and the desired outcome, professionals can select the right equation or algorithm to achieve the best results.

4.2 Importance of Knowing the Right Equation

Choosing the right mathematical equation is critical for automating processes and solving real-world business problems with machine learning. Without a strong foundation in math, professionals may struggle to Apply the correct equations and optimize their models effectively.

5. Math in Industry

The importance of math in the industry extends beyond theory and algorithm selection. Many job profiles, such as machine learning engineers and AI engineers, require a deep understanding of the mathematical concepts and equations associated with data science.

5.1 Choosing the Right Algorithm for Automation

When tasked with automating a process or developing a solution, professionals rely on their knowledge of mathematical equations to select the appropriate algorithm. Understanding the underlying math allows them to build accurate and efficient models suitable for the automation requirements.

5.2 Hiring Based on Project Experience

In the hiring process, companies often prioritize candidates with Relevant project experience. Rather than focusing solely on how much math a candidate knows, organizations Seek individuals who can apply their mathematical knowledge in practical projects. Demonstrating proficiency in specific equations and their applications can significantly impact one's chances of being hired.

6. Learning Math as a Beginner

For beginners in data science or machine learning, the key is to get started on a solid foundation. Much like driving a sports car, mastery of complex mathematical concepts requires starting with the basics. Beginners must focus on understanding simpler equations, working with simple data sets, and gradually progressing to more complex algorithms.

6.1 Focusing on Project Demands

Aspiring data scientists should prioritize learning math that aligns with the demands of the projects they are working on. By identifying the specific mathematical requirements for a project, individuals can focus their efforts on learning the relevant concepts and equations, ensuring their skills remain practical and applicable.

6.2 Starting with Simple Data Sets and Algorithms

Beginners can begin their Journey by working with simple data sets and algorithms. This allows them to gain hands-on experience while gradually developing a strong foundation in math. As they tackle more complex projects, they can expand their mathematical knowledge accordingly.

6.3 Understanding the Why behind Math

Rather than just learning equations for the sake of it, beginners should strive to understand the underlying principles and the reasons behind using particular equations. This deep understanding enables professionals to make informed decisions and select the most appropriate mathematical tools.

7. The Importance of Math at Every Experience Level

Mathematics remains a crucial element for professionals at all experience levels within the field of data science and machine learning. Whether one is a fresher or an experienced practitioner, staying proficient in math is essential for success.

7.1 Math for Freshers and Experienced Professionals

Freshers entering the field need to invest time in learning the requisite math fundamentals. Companies typically value relevant project experience, suggesting that a deep understanding of mathematical concepts enables candidates to effectively contribute to projects. Similarly, experienced professionals should continually enhance their math skills to keep up with evolving technologies and industry demands.

8. Conclusion

In conclusion, math is a vital component of learning data science and machine learning. It forms the basis for complex algorithms, models, and decision-making processes. Professionals in these fields must recognize the importance of math and continually enhance their mathematical knowledge to excel in their careers. By understanding when and why to use specific equations, individuals can effectively apply mathematical concepts and drive meaningful insights in their projects.

Most people like

Find AI tools in Toolify

Join TOOLIFY to find the ai tools

Get started

Sign Up
App rating
4.9
AI Tools
20k+
Trusted Users
5000+
No complicated
No difficulty
Free forever
Browse More Content